Godfather of AI joins calls to slow artificial intelligence
Geoffrey Hinton, widely recognized as the godfather of artificial intelligence, has joined calls for AI companies to significantly slow their development pace. Speaking to ABC Radio, Hinton warned that systems exceeding human intelligence may emerge within a decade, posing a severe risk of escaping human control. He endorsed Anthropic CEO Dario Amodei’s recent proposal to pace frontier capabilities, citing insufficient evidence to guarantee safety.
